How to Choose Reliable Bulk Fuel Suppliers for Your Business?

Finding a dependable bulk fuel supplier is critical to the success and continuity of your business operations. Selecting the right provider ensures that your business maintains efficiency, keeps machines running, and avoids unnecessary downtime. Here are key factors to consider when searching for a reliable bulk fuel supplier.

Assessing Supplier Reputation and Reliability

First and foremost, investigate a supplier’s reputation in the industry. A well-regarded supplier is likely to provide quality service and be more reliable. Read reviews, ask for referrals, and check their track record for consistency in delivery and service. Reliability also translates into the ability to deliver fuel on time and in the correct quantities, so evaluating a supplier’s delivery history is fundamental.

Evaluating the Quality of Fuel

The quality of the fuel provided can significantly impact the performance and longevity of your equipment. High-quality fuel can reduce maintenance costs and improve efficiency. Requesting detailed information about their fuel, including additives and certifications, can give you an insight into the quality they supply.

Considering the Range of Services Offered

  • On-site fueling

  • Emergency services

  • Fuel management systems

It’s advantageous to consider suppliers offering a broad range of services. This may include on-site fueling to save time, emergency services for unplanned needs, and advanced fuel management systems to optimize your fuel usage.

Pricing and Payment Terms

While cost shouldn’t be the sole determining factor, competitive pricing is important for your bottom line. Examine the supplier’s pricing structure and check if they offer flexible payment terms that align with your cash flow. It’s also worth considering whether they provide fixed pricing contracts to guard against market volatility.

Checking for Environmental Compliance

Environmental responsibility is becoming increasingly important. Ensure that the bulk fuel supplier adheres to all local and federal environmental regulations, which demonstrates their commitment to sustainability and reduces the risk of fines or penalties for your business.

Exploring Customer Support and Service

Good customer service can make a significant difference, especially when dealing with supply issues. Evaluate the supplier’s responsiveness, the expertise of their staff, and their willingness to go above and beyond to meet your business needs.

License and Insurance Verification

Verifying a supplier’s licenses and insurance is a non-negotiable step. Proper licensing ensures they are legally authorized to supply fuel, while insurance protects your business from liability in the event of an accident or spill.

Availability and Flexibility

Check if the supplier can accommodate your specific needs—such as flexible delivery schedules and responsiveness to demand fluctuations. Businesses, particularly those with irregular fuel usage patterns, will benefit from a supplier that offers adaptability.

Delivery Options

Consider suppliers that provide a range of delivery options to suit your operational requirements. This flexibility in delivery can be critical in managing your supply chain effectively.

Strategic Partnerships and Network

When selecting a supplier, their network strength is a key element that can greatly influence the reliability and consistency of supply. Especially in industries prone to fluctuations and shortages, having a supplier with well-established strategic partnerships can be the difference between a seamless operation and one that is riddled with supply chain disruptions. 

It is essential to evaluate the relationships your potential suppliers have built with critical industry players like refineries and transportation services.

Importance of a Supplier’s Strong Network

A supplier’s network can greatly affect their ability to deliver products consistently. In times of shortage or market stress, those with a strong network are more likely to continue providing you with the materials or products you need to keep your business running smoothly.

  • Continuity in Supply: Suppliers with a robust network can leverage their relationships to fulfill their obligations to you, even during challenging periods, ensuring you have a steady supply.

  • Access to Resources: A strong network can also mean that your supplier has access to a wider array of resources, potentially offering you a broader range of products or alternatives if needed.

Benefits of Established Supplier Partnerships

Partnerships within a supplier’s network are significant; they often indicate the supplier’s reputation and reliability within the industry. Established partnerships typically mean that the supplier has demonstrated a track record of delivering value to their associates.

  • Refinery Partnerships: Direct connections with refineries mean that a supplier can assure higher quality and potentially better pricing due to their ability to buy in bulk or negotiate directly. Assess if the supplier has strong relationships with multiple refineries to avoid being affected by regional shortages or specific refinery disruptions.

  • Transportation Services: With a network that includes reliable transportation services, a supplier can more effectively manage logistics, minimize delays, and reduce the risk of transportation-related issues that might affect your supply.

A supplier with extensive and strategic connections with refineries and transportation services, as well as other entities, can deliver a dependable supply to your business, even in challenging market situations. These aspects should definitely be considered when deciding on your potential supplier to ensure uninterrupted operations and long-term success.
